Chopra Champion of Champions with PING
Ping Golf, January 7, 2008 Read Full Article at Ping Golf>
PING pro Daniel Chopra cashed a $1.1 million check and drove off with a new Mercedes for winning the PGA Tour's season-opening Mercedes Championship, but it was an invitation to his first Masters that was on the top of his mind. The 34-year-old birdied the fourth playoff hole to beat the winners-only field and fulfill his "lifelong dream" of playing in The Masters. In carding an 18-under-par total over the Plantation Course at Kapalua, Chopra led the field in putting with his Anser2 putter—holing a tour-record tying nine putts over 20 feet for the tournament. He also played S59 irons (3-9, PW) and two PING Tour wedges (52 & 58 degree).
